Common Mistakes / What Most People Get Wrong
Even with a tool, misconceptions stick around. Here are the biggest pitfalls and how the gizmo helps you dodge them No workaround needed..
1. Confusing Coefficients with Subscripts
- Mistake: Changing the subscript in a formula instead of the coefficient.
- Fix: The gizmo locks subscripts and only lets you alter coefficients, so you can’t accidentally write H₂O as H₂₂O.
2. Forgetting the Law of Conservation of Mass
- Mistake: Balancing only the left side and assuming it’s done.
- Fix: The gizmo’s red highlights show you exactly where the atom counts differ, forcing you to balance both sides.
3. Over‑Complicating with Extra Numbers
- Mistake: Adding unnecessary numbers to make the equation look “polished.”
- Fix: The gizmo automatically reduces the equation to its simplest integer form.
